About the role

Performs and assists with a variety of echocardiographic tests and other related duties, working under limited supervision to ensure high quality diagnostic studies. Reports to the manager of Non-Invasive Cardiology Services.

Responsibilities

  • Produce echocardiograms that satisfy the laboratory protocols for standard transthoracic imaging and for special conditions including valvular heart disease, stress echocardiography, 3D echocardiography and strain imaging.
  • Participates fully in all the routine procedures within the laboratory, including transesophageal echo, stress echo, and structural heart disease cases.
  • Identify studies which require vetting for appropriateness. When present, recognizes true cardiac emergencies, including cardiac tamponade, aortic dissection, and acute valvular regurgitation. Uses contrast for appropriate indications.
  • Has facility with a full variety of special indications, including patients with ventricular assist devices (LVAD and RVAD), Impella pumps, extracorporeal membrane oxygenation (ECMO).
  • Performs echocardiograms on patients participating in clinical trials according to the prescribed protocol.

Qualifications

  • Associates/Bachelor's Degree in Health Care.
  • One year previous echo experience.
  • Two years echo experience in a hospital setting preferred.
  • RCS by CCI or RDCS by ARDMS.
